Efficacy and Safety of VMX Eye Drops for Dry Eye Disease

This multicenter, randomized, double-blind study evaluates the safety and effectiveness of VMX eye drops in patients with dry eye disease. It aims to improve tear film stability, reduce dry eye symptoms, and enhance patients' quality of life compared to standard treatment.

Eligibility criteria

Qualifiers

Patients with an age of ≥ 18 and ≤ 80 years

Tear Osmolarity >308 mOsm/L

TBUT < 10 seconds

Schirmer I test ≥ 5 mm and ≤ 14 mm at 5 minutes

Disqualifiers

Use of systemic medications which may affect a dry eye condition within 1 month prior to study enrolment (e.g. low-dose aspirin, antihistamines, decongestants, antipsychotics, parkinsonism medications, anticholinergics, oral isotretinoin, and oral diazepam)

Patients with a score of ≤ 4 mm at 5 minutes on the Schirmer I test

Patients that suffer of ocular allergy pathology (seasonal and chronic)

Ongoing ocular or systemic infectious conditions
